当然可以!下面是一篇基于多年自媒体经验的关于如何在《王者荣耀》、《英雄联盟》等游戏中使用SLS(Serverless Computing Service)来实现自动化的内容生成和发布策略,这篇文案将重点介绍如何利用SLS来自动化游戏中的文本生成任务。
在当今快速变化的游戏市场中,持续的创新和优化是保持竞争力的关键,通过利用云服务提供商如阿里云的SLS(Serverless Computing Service),我们可以轻松地实现游戏内容的自动化生产,本文将详细介绍如何在《王者荣耀》、《英雄联盟》等游戏中使用SLS来实现这一目标。
1. 理解SLS的基本概念
SLS是阿里云推出的一种无服务器计算平台,它允许开发者无需关心底层基础设施,专注于编写代码,通过SLS,我们可以轻松部署、扩展和管理各种微服务应用程序。
2. 在《王者荣耀》中的应用
在《王者荣耀》中,我们可以通过SLS来实现以下几个关键功能:
文本生成:可以根据玩家的喜好和偏好生成个性化的游戏推荐。
AI助手:开发一个智能聊天机器人,提供即时帮助和建议。
动态角色定制:根据游戏进度和用户反馈调整角色属性。
3. 配置SLS环境
你需要在阿里云控制台创建一个新的SLS项目,并配置相应的权限,你可以选择使用Java或Python作为编程语言进行开发。
4. 编写自动化脚本
使用SLS提供的SDK编写自动化脚本,以下是一个简单的示例,展示如何使用Java SDK在王者荣耀
中生成文本推荐:
import com.aliyun.dysmsapi20170525.*; import com.aliyun.teaopenapi.models.*; import java.util.Map; public class TextRecommendation { public static void main(String[] args) throws Exception { // 初始化DysmsClient实例 Client client = new Client("<your-access-key-id>", "<your-access-key-secret>", "<your-region-id>"); // 创建Request对象 CreateTextMessageRequest request = new CreateTextMessageRequest(); // 设置消息信息 Message message = new Message(); message.setMsgType("text"); message.setTemplateCode("<template-code>"); message.setSignName("<sign-name>"); message.setTemplateParam("{\"key\":\"value\"}"); message.setTo("<phone-number>"); // 将消息添加到Request对象中 request.setMessage(message); // 发送请求 CreateTextMessageResponse response = client.createTextMessage(request); // 打印响应结果 System.out.println(response.getBody()); } }
5. 测试和优化
在实际应用中,你需要对生成的内容进行测试,确保其质量和实用性,根据用户的反馈不断优化脚本和模板。
6. 结语
通过使用阿里云的SLS,我们可以轻松地实现游戏内容的自动化生产,这种技术不仅提高了生产效率,还使得游戏内容更加个性化和有趣,希望这篇文案对你有所帮助!